Executive Summary
Updated on Jan 21, 2024

We compared Orca Security and Darktrace based on our users reviews in five parameters. After reading the collected data, you can find our conclusion below:

  • Ease of Deployment: Orca Security's setup process is deemed simple and direct, requiring only a few minutes for a single account. It boasts excellent responsiveness and minimal latency, intending to broaden its reach to private and on-premises environments. Conversely, Darktrace's setup experience differs, as it can be either time-consuming or swift, depending on the user. Customization and configuration may be required, but once established, it is straightforward to upkeep.
  • Features: According to our reviews, Orca Security has extensive range of automated scanning capabilities and the users love its user-friendly interface, and its ability to identify secrets within infrastructure. Darktrace is valued for its adeptness in detecting threats, its artificial intelligence module, and its autonomous behavior analytics.
  • Room for Improvement: Orca Security can enhance its features by implementing automatic virus and malware remediation, providing more detailed and explanatory dashboards, resolving loading difficulties and integrating with other security solutions. Darktrace should focus on reducing false positives, streamlining the configuration process, adjusting pricing and enhancing integration functionalities.
  • Pricing and ROI: Orca Security's setup cost is competitively priced compared to other options in the market, offering affordability and potentially being cheaper than certain competitors. Meanwhile, Darktrace's setup cost tends to be high, ranging from over $100,000 annually to approximately $30,000 to $54,000 per year. Orca Security provides value that justifies its ROI, while Darktrace offers a strong defense against attacks, identification of weaknesses, and effective handling of security incidents.
  • Service and Support: Orca Security's customer service is highly appreciated for being extremely helpful, responsive, and considerate towards customers' requirements. Their support has proven to be advantageous, despite occasional delays in response time. Darktrace's customer support team is commended for their proactive and supportive approach, infused with a personal touch. Nevertheless, there is room for improvement in tackling intricate deployments, and a few customers have experienced intermittent delays in receiving assistance.

Comparison Results: Orca Security has a smooth setup and deployment process, providing clear insight into assets with user-friendly features, all at a competitive price. While lacking automated remediation and advanced customization options, it still offers strong advantages. Comparatively, Darktrace has a more diverse setup method but stands out in threat detection, network monitoring, and AI capabilities. It offers decent protection and flexibility but requires enhancement in pricing, integration, and reporting. Customer reviews indicate that both products offer attentive customer support, although Darktrace may face challenges with complex deployments.

    Darktrace Cyber AI Loop

    The Darktrace Cyber AI Loop introduces an advanced artificial intelligence-based system for cybersecurity, designed to build a self-improving defense mechanism. This system functions like a closed loop, where each stage feeds information and insights into the next, amplifying the overall effectiveness of the platform.

    The key components of the loop are:

    • DETECT - An AI engine that monitors your network and endpoints for anomalous activity, constantly learning the normal behavior of your users and devices. It identifies suspicious patterns and potential threats in real-time, even from never-before-seen attacks.
    • PREVENT - This proactive arm analyzes vulnerabilities and identifies weaknesses in your IT infrastructure. It prioritizes patching and configuration changes to harden defenses before attackers can exploit those vulnerabilities.
    • RESPOND - When DETECT identifies a threat, RESPOND takes immediate action to contain and neutralize it. This can involve isolating compromised devices, disrupting attacker activity, and automatically escalating critical incidents to human analysts.
    • HEAL - This newest addition to the loop focuses on post-incident recovery. It automatically restores compromised systems, cleans infected files, and helps to prevent the attack from spreading further.

    Darktrace's AI algorithms can identify threats that traditional security tools might miss. It continuously learns and updates its understanding of what is normal for each environment, ensuring that it can quickly detect and respond to unusual activities that could indicate a breach. Darktrace's Antigena module can autonomously respond to threats in real time. This is particularly crucial in containing fast-moving threats like ransomware, where every second counts.

        Key Platform Features: 

        • Agentless: Complete, centralized coverage of the entire cloud estate, without the need for installing and configuring agents or layering together multiple siloed tools. Full visibility of cloud misconfigurations, vulnerabilities, workload protection, malware scanning, image scanning, file integrity monitoring and more.

        • Asset Inventory: Get a complete inventory of all your public cloud assets, including detailed information on installed OSes, software, and applications, as well as data and network assets such as storage buckets, Virtual Private Clouds (VPCs), and Security Groups.

        • Attack Path Analysis: Visualize attack vectors to critical assets or crown jewels. See which assets are susceptible to lateral movement, assume roles, privilege escalation, and more.

        • Risk Prioritization: Prioritize the 1% of risks that matter the most, based on impact scores. Secure the vulnerabilities and misconfigured targets (critical assets) and eliminate the potential risks residing on the attack paths to those targets.

        • Cloud Threat Detection: Monitor for malicious activity within your entire cloud estate. Be aware of detected threats, user behavior anomalies and more.

        • Breach Forensics: Log every change and all activity into a central repository for investigation procedures to confirm or deny entry and compromises within the cloud estate.

        • Cloud To Dev (Shift Left): Orca’s built-in shift left capabilities enables DevOps to focus more security attention earlier in the CI/CD pipelines. Security teams are able to trace a production risk (misconfiguration or vulnerability) directly to the original source code repository from which it came, even down to the exact line of code that is at the root of the identified risk. 

        • Compliance: Choose from over 60 preconfigured compliance frameworks, cloud security best practices, CIS Benchmarks, or design and build your own compliance framework for fast and continuous reporting.

        • Security Score: The Orca Security Score is found on Orca’s Risk Dashboard and is updated daily. The overall score is calculated based on performance in the following five categories - Suspicious Activity, IAM, Data at Risk, Vulnerable Assets, and Responsiveness. Since the scores are percentage based and not raw numbers, you can objectively make comparisons to other organizations within your industry or business units of different sizes. In addition to reporting to senior management, the Orca Security Score can help with internal self-monitoring, as a way of measuring risk mitigation efforts, to know where to focus efforts, and track progress.
